Technical Skill Enhancement

Technical proficiency serves as the foundation of esports excellence, demanding continuous improvement through structured training approaches. Gaming coaches deploy targeted drills tackling game-specific mechanics, reaction time optimisation, and decision-making speed. Players complete rigorous training analysing pro-level gameplay, breaking down tactics, and refining technique repeatedly until movements become instinctive. Coaches utilise performance analytics software tracking accuracy metrics, positioning efficiency, and economy handling. This data-driven approach identifies personal gaps, allowing customised coaching programs that progressively enhance technical capabilities.

Beyond mechanical skill, coaches stress adaptability and situational awareness across varied challenging scenarios. Training involves analysing competitor tendencies, recognising tactical patterns, and developing counter-strategies instantaneously. Players take part in scrimmages against ever more challenging opponents, gradually expanding their competitive comfort zone. Coaches provide real-time feedback during matches, identifying strategic errors and tactical opportunities. This ongoing refinement process speeds up development trajectories, converting inexperienced players into tactically skilled competitors capable of performing intricate strategies under tournament pressure.

Mental Resilience and Sports Psychology

Psychological conditioning distinguishes elite esports athletes from competent players, as mental fortitude significantly impacts tournament performance outcomes. Gaming coaches employ sports psychologists focusing on stress management, confidence building, and pressure-handling techniques. Players develop mindfulness practices, visualisation routines, and cognitive reframing strategies counteracting performance anxiety. Coaches create pre-match rituals promoting psychological readiness whilst cultivating post-defeat resilience mechanisms. Through systematic exposure with high-pressure scenarios during training, players gradually strengthen emotional regulation capabilities, enabling reliable execution regardless of competitive intensity.

Mental resilience training encompasses building healthy coping mechanisms for inevitable defeats and competitive disappointments. Coaches facilitate debriefing sessions transforming losses into constructive learning opportunities rather than demoralising experiences. Players establish personal accountability systems, establishing achievable development goals and celebrating incremental progress. Coaches emphasise growth mindset philosophies, viewing obstacles as growth opportunities rather than threats. This mental approach fosters long-term motivation sustainability, preventing burnout whilst maintaining competitive hunger throughout extended professional careers.
